And though it hasn’t erupted since sometime between 1480 and 1600, Haleakala is expected to erupt again in the future. The Haleakala National Park is home to more endangered species than any other U.S. National Park. Haleakala National Park contains the beautiful ‘Ohe‘o Gulch (also known—erroneously—as the Seven Sacred Pools) of Kipahulu Valley, a series of cascading waterfalls and pools. Haleakala National Park, Hawaii Known as the House of Sun, Haleakala National Park is the highest peak on the island of Maui. The land was designated a national park in 1976 and its boundaries expanded in 2005. The Hawaiian silversword is an endangered plant that cannot be found anywhere else in the world. Birds that can be found in Haleakala National Park include the Hawaiian Petrel, a migratory seabird, the Hawaiian goose (nene), honeycreepers, common myna, Eurasian skylark, chukar, black noddy, house finch, rock dove, and peregrine falcon, among many others.
